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"connection with candidate"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ing a relationship or interaction with a job candidate or individual being considered for a position. Example: "We need to establish a strong connection with the candidate to ensure they feel comfortable during the interview process."

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
relationship with candidate
Focuses on the bond or association rather than the interaction.
association with candidate
Emphasizes the link or connection, possibly formal or informal.
link to candidate
Highlights a direct connection or pathway to the candidate.
affiliation with candidate
Suggests a formal or declared association, like membership.
involvement with candidate
Focuses on active participation or engagement.
interaction with candidate
Highlights direct communication or encounters.
contact with candidate
Emphasizes communication or being in touch.
liaison with candidate
Suggests serving as a link between entities and the candidate.
rapport with candidate
Focuses on a harmonious or sympathetic connection.
alignment with candidate
Highlights agreement or shared principles.
FAQs
How to use "connection with candidate" in a sentence?
You can use "connection with candidate" to describe the relationship or interaction between a person and someone running for a position. For example: "Establishing a personal "connection with candidate" is important for voters".
What can I say instead of "connection with candidate"?
You can use alternatives like "relationship with candidate", "association with candidate", or "link to candidate" depending on the specific context.
Which is correct, "connection with candidate" or "connection to candidate"?
Both "connection with candidate" and "connection to candidate" are grammatically correct, but "connection with candidate" often implies a more personal or interactive association.
What's the difference between "connection with candidate" and "support for candidate"?
"Connection with candidate" suggests a relationship or association, while "support for candidate" indicates active backing or endorsement. One implies a link, the other implies advocacy.
